According to Stratistics MRC, the Global Pediatric Perfusion Systems Market is accounted for $346.96 million in 2023 and is expected to reach $626.16 million by 2030 growing at a CAGR of 8.8% during the forecast period. Pediatric perfusion systems are specialised medical setups crafted specifically for infants and children requiring cardiopulmonary bypass during cardiac surgeries. Tailored to their unique physiologies, these systems include smaller oxygenators, pumps, tubing and monitoring devices. They maintain vital functions like oxygenation, temperature control and blood circulation during procedures, ensuring safe and effective support for pediatric cardiac surgery while considering the unique needs of younger patients.
According to American Heart Association, Inc.'s fact sheet 2022, congenital heart defects are expected to affect around 40,000 infants in the U.S. each year.
Rising incidence of congenital heart defects
The increasing prevalence of congenital heart defects among infants and children globally serves as a significant driver in the pediatric Perfusion systems market. With rising awareness and improved diagnostic capabilities, more cases are being identified early, necessitating advanced cardiac surgeries. Pediatric perfusion systems play a crucial role in these surgeries, providing specialised support tailored to the smaller anatomies and unique physiological requirements of pediatric patients. As the demand for corrective cardiac procedures rises due to the growing incidence of congenital heart defects, the need for effective perfusion systems amplifies accordingly.
High cost of equipment and procedures
The high cost associated with pediatric perfusion systems and related procedures poses a significant restraint on the market. The specialised nature of equipment tailored for pediatric patients, coupled with stringent safety standards and advanced technologies, contributes to elevated costs. Additionally, the expenses incurred in maintaining and upgrading these systems, along with the need for highly skilled personnel, further escalate the overall expenditure. This high cost limits accessibility for certain healthcare facilities or regions, hindering widespread adoption despite the critical need for these systems in pediatric cardiac surgeries.
Growing demand for customized solutions
Pediatric patients exhibit diverse anatomies and physiological needs, and there's a growing emphasis on tailored systems and technologies to address these variations. Companies focusing on adaptable, patient-specific solutions, such as adjustable pumps, smaller oxygenators, and specialised monitoring devices, can capitalise on this trend. Offering customised options that cater to specific patient requirements not only enhances patient outcomes but also establishes a competitive edge, fostering innovation and market expansion in pediatric perfusion systems.
Rapid technological changes
Rapid technological changes pose a threat to the market due to the risk of rendering existing systems obsolete. Continuous advancements may lead to shorter lifecycles for equipment, potentially making current systems outdated faster. This necessitates frequent upgrades or investments in newer technologies, increasing costs for healthcare facilities. Additionally, the need for training staff on updated systems and ensuring compatibility with evolving standards can create logistical challenges. This swift pace of technological evolution might deter investments in current solutions, impacting market stability.
The COVID-19 pandemic has influenced the market by causing disruptions in elective surgeries, including pediatric cardiac procedures, where these systems are crucial. Reduced hospital capacities, redirected resources, and safety measures resulted in deferred non-emergency surgeries. This decreased demand for pediatric perfusion systems temporarily, affecting market growth. However, the urgent nature of many pediatric cardiac surgeries has sustained some demand despite these challenges.

In December 2023, Vascular Perfusion Solutions (VPS), Inc., is a San Antonio based medical device startup company focused on developing novel prolonged organ preservation technologies prior to transplantation, has received a $25,000 grant from the Southwest-Midwest National Pediatric Device Innovation Consortium (SWPDC).
In March 2023, LivaNova PLC, a market-leading medical technology and innovation company, announced it received U.S. Food and Drug Administration (FDA) 510(k) clearance for its Essenz™ Heart-Lung Machine (HLM). With FDA clearance, LivaNova initiates the commercial launch of Essenz in the U.S. The Company also recently received approval for the Essenz HLM from Health Canada and the Japanese Pharmaceuticals and Medical Devices Agency (PMDA).
